Common symptoms of trauma: Is this what you’re experiencing?

Feeling anxious, on edge, or easily startled

Trouble sleeping or frequent nightmares

Difficulty trusting others or feeling safe in relationships

Avoiding reminders of certain people, places, or experiences

Feeling emotionally numb or disconnected

Flashbacks or intrusive memories

This isn't a complete list. People struggling with trauma may experience persistent shame, guilt, or self-blame. You may find it difficult to concentrate or stay present. Physical symptoms (such as chronic tension, headaches, or stomach issues) are common too.

Discover how trauma therapy works

Trauma therapy is a specialized kind of support that helps you safely process painful or overwhelming experiences.
It’s not about reliving the trauma but learning how it’s affecting your mind, body, and emotions today—and finding ways to heal from it.

Through therapy, you build tools to manage symptoms, understand your reactions, and create a sense of safety inside yourself so that trauma no longer controls your life.

Trauma counselling modalities I use to help you heal

Healing trauma isn’t one-size-fits-all, so I draw from several approaches tailored to your needs. This includes:

Emotion-focused therapy (EFT):

Helps you address attachment wounds and rebuild trust and connection.

Internal Family Systems (IFS):

Allows you to explore and harmonize your inner parts so that you can reconnect with your core Self.

Accelerated Resolution Therapy (ART):

Enables you to gently reprocess distressing memories.

Mindfulness and somatic techniques:

Help you feel grounded and safe in your body again.

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R):

It's an evidence-based alternative to traditional talk therapy that helps your brain process and heal from difficult experiences. Using bilateral stimulation, EMDR engages the brain’s natural ability to calm emotional intensity and create a greater sense of balance, while updating underlying negative beliefs that are holding you back.

Clients notice significant improvements in symptoms such as anxiety, stress, low mood, and other lingering effects of past traumas, allowing you to feel more present and resilient in daily life.

ART trauma therapy: Break the loop

Trauma often leaves the brain and body feeling like they’re stuck in a loop—reliving the same images, sensations, and emotional reactions over and over. Even when you know the event is in the past, your nervous system doesn’t always get the memo.

Accelerated Resolution Therapy (ART) helps the brain break that loop.

Using soothing, back-and-forth eye movements (similar to what your brain does during REM sleep), ART allows you to reprocess a traumatic memory in a way that feels safe, contained, and often surprisingly manageable. You don’t need to talk through every detail—instead, the process works at a deeper, neurological level to shift how the memory is stored.

With ART, the distressing images are replaced with new ones you choose. You’ll still remember the facts of what happened, but the emotional pain and body tension linked to that memory are significantly reduced—or gone altogether.

IFS trauma therapy: Feel free from the emotional weight you’ve been carrying around

Internal Family Systems (IFS) is a compassionate, evidence-based approach that helps you understand and heal the different “parts” of yourself—like the inner critic, the anxious part, the one who shuts down, or the part that keeps everything together. These parts often develop in response to difficult or overwhelming experiences and have been working hard to protect you.

In the context of trauma, IFS is especially powerful. Trauma can leave us feeling fragmented or stuck in survival mode, with parts of us carrying pain while others try to manage or avoid it. IFS helps you gently connect with these parts, understand their roles, and begin to unburden the emotional weight they’ve been holding—without needing to relive the trauma in detail.

As you build a relationship with your internal system and access your core Self—the calm, compassionate center of who you are—you can create more space for healing, clarity, and connection.
